Factors Influencing Headphone Prices

Several essential elements affect the price of headphones, that include:

1. Type of Headphones

  • Over-Ear: Known for their convenience and sound quality, over-ear headphones generally range from mid to high price points.
  • On-Ear: These use a more portable choice and typically sit at a lower price compared to over-ear options.
  • In-Ear: Also called earphones, these are typically more cost effective, however high-end models can be pricey.
  • True Wireless: TWS headphones have gained popularity for their benefit but can vary substantially in cost.

2. Brand Reputation

  • Brands like Bose and Sennheiser command greater rates due to their recognized reputation and quality control, while lesser-known brand names may use more affordable choices without considerable brand backing.

3. Sound Quality

  • Headphones with much better drivers and advanced sound technologies, such as noise cancellation or adaptive sound settings, come at a premium price.

4. Product and Build Quality

  • Headphones made from resilient products like metal and high-quality plastics are typically more pricey due to the increased production cost.

5. Features

  • Wired vs. Wireless: Wireless headphones often cost more due to Bluetooth innovation and battery management systems.
  • Sound Cancellation: Active sound cancellation innovation substantially increases the price of headphones.
  • Microphone Quality: Integrated premium microphones boost functionality, especially for players and specialists, causing a greater cost.

6. Target Audience

  • Headphones developed for audiophiles or professional studio usage usually fall within a greater price bracket due to precision engineering and premium materials.

Headphones Pricing Tiers

When searching for headphones, it can be helpful to classify them into distinct rates tiers. Below is a breakdown of rates tiers and examples of popular headphone models in each classification.

Price RangeDescriptionExample Models
Budget plan (<<₤ 50)Basic features, good quality, ideal for casual usage.Anker SoundCore, JLab Audio
Mid-range (₤ 50 - ₤ 150)Balanced sound quality, more comfort, additional features like sound isolation.Sony WH-CH710N, Apple AirPods
High-end (₤ 150 - ₤ 300)Superior sound quality, outstanding construct quality, features like sound cancellation.Bose QuietComfort 35 II, Sennheiser HD 558
Audiophile (₤ 300+)Exceptional audio fidelity, frequently including high-end materials and technologies.Audeze LCD-X, Focal Stellia

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Why are some headphones so expensive?

Expensive headphones typically include top quality products, advanced innovations, remarkable sound engineering, and trusted brand name backing. Audiophiles and professionals might discover these functions worth the investment.

2. Are more affordable headphones worth purchasing?

Less expensive headphones can be a good alternative for casual users or those just beginning with headphones. They typically provide decent sound quality for daily usage but may do not have toughness and advanced features.

3. Do I need noise cancellation for regular usage?

If you often find yourself in loud environments or commute regularly, sound cancellation can enhance your listening experience. However, if you typically utilize headphones in quieter settings, it may not be required.

4. image source How do I choose the ideal headphones for me?

Consider your primary use case (casual listening, gaming, professional work), sound preferences, spending plan, and necessary functions before making a purchase.

5. Are wireless headphones worth the price?

Wireless headphones provide convenience and portability. Regardless of normally being costlier than wired choices, numerous users find the advantages surpass the cost.
